How Common Is The Last Name Schiftner? popularity and diffusion

Schiftner is the 2,203,767th most numerous surname on a global scale, held by around 1 in 98,480,350 people. This surname is primarily found in Europe, where 76 percent of Schiftner reside; 70 percent reside in Western Europe and 69 percent reside in Germanic Europe.

The last name is most prevalent in Austria, where it is carried by 32 people, or 1 in 266,107. In Austria it is mostly concentrated in: Tyrol, where 44 percent are found, Carinthia, where 25 percent are found and Lower Austria, where 22 percent are found. Not including Austria this last name occurs in 6 countries. It is also found in Germany, where 26 percent are found and The United States, where 18 percent are found.
